› Fóruns › Banco de dados Oracle › variavel = branco › variavel = branco
17 de junho de 2009 às 12:00 am
#87328
Participante
MELHORANDO A PERGUNTA,
PARA INSERIR EM UMA VARIAVEL VALORES DE OUTRA TABELA MAS QUE POSSUEM VALOR EM BRANCO COMO QUE TRATO-AS NO SELECT PÓS INSERT?
EX.: INSERT INTO NOME DA TABELA
(
CODV0808
CODV0809
)
SELECT
CODV0808 CASE WHEN (V0808)=’ ‘ THEN 3
ELSE TO_NUMBER(B0808)
END
CODV0809 CASE WHEN (TO_NUMBER(V0808)=2) THEN 3
ELSE TO_NUMBER V0809
END
FROM NOME TABELA DA TABELA 1;
SENDO QUE NA TABELA 1:CODV0808 POSSUI VALORES 1. 2, NULL, ‘ ‘(BRANCO)
CODV0809 POSSUI 1, 0, 2, 3
OBS.: NA TABELA CRIADA ELAS RECEBERA NOT NULL
DESDE JÁ AGRADEÇO A ATENÇÃO DE TODOS